- Report to the project manager.
- Work with planning on WO reviews and compliance with associated DC's.
- Ensure field teams (32 IBEW Journeymen) have correct documentation or construction aids to perform work.
- Provide technical oversight in the field to ensure quality is in accordance with station procedures or design.
- Review schedules and plans for correct tasks, durations and resources needed.
- Ensure materials or tooling are available for upcoming activities (AVR and Gen Relay upgrade at Surry currently in process).
- Conduct running and cable pulling of medium to low voltage.
- Panel wiring and replacement in the shop or field Emergency Switchgear Room.
- Communicate with engineering team members and engineering manager to maintain the engineering scope work breakdown structure.
- Communicate changes/updates from the engineering team to other project groups (i.e. scheduling, project controls, construction).
- Organize meetings (internal or client) as required by the engineering team and develop meeting minutes.
- Report on action items from engineering meetings for input to the action items register.
- Coordinate requests for information to vendors/client as identified by the engineering team.
- Act as project management and construction management support role.
- Support weld engineering, quality control, logistics, with site field activities.
- Act as the site interface between the client and Aecon site management.
- Electrical Engineering Degree.
- Excellent interpersonal, communication (both oral and written) skills.
- Strong interpersonal skills in communicating with a large team.
- Organizational and time management skills. Ability to prioritize and multi-task/service oriented.
- Thrives in a fast‑paced environment.
